cpufreq: cris: don't initialize part of policy set by core
authorViresh Kumar <viresh.kumar@linaro.org>
Thu, 3 Oct 2013 14:58:37 +0000 (20:28 +0530)
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>
Tue, 15 Oct 2013 22:50:29 +0000 (00:50 +0200)
Many common initializations of struct policy are moved to core now and hence
this driver doesn't need to do it. This patch removes such code.

Most recent of those changes is to call ->get() in the core after calling
->init().

Cc: Mikael Starvik <starvik@axis.com>
Signed-off-by: Viresh Kumar <viresh.kumar@linaro.org>
Acked-by: Jesper Nilsson <jesper.nilsson@axis.com>
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
drivers/cpufreq/cris-artpec3-cpufreq.c
drivers/cpufreq/cris-etraxfs-cpufreq.c

index d26f4e45dabdc09329dd9331c736a6dc40ee0f4e..4d88e4fa2ad42ca391eff5c2a616118e8695a64c 100644 (file)
@@ -73,7 +73,6 @@ static int cris_freq_cpu_init(struct cpufreq_policy *policy)
 {
        /* cpuinfo and default policy values */
        policy->cpuinfo.transition_latency = 1000000; /* 1ms */
-       policy->cur = cris_freq_get_cpu_frequency(0);
 
        return cpufreq_table_validate_and_show(policy, cris_freq_table);
 }
index d384e638fdbb5e5e63606e6831fce1f21e245517..f7d2d49f7c07d45e9b1d0e2058d62a700e4b6e6c 100644 (file)
@@ -72,7 +72,6 @@ static int cris_freq_cpu_init(struct cpufreq_policy *policy)
 {
        /* cpuinfo and default policy values */
        policy->cpuinfo.transition_latency = 1000000;   /* 1ms */
-       policy->cur = cris_freq_get_cpu_frequency(0);
 
        return cpufreq_table_validate_and_show(policy, cris_freq_table);
 }